Looking to kick-start your first weekend of 2013? Agenda‘s got you covered:

Mark Bazer returns to the Hideout with the latest edition of the Interview Show, a monthly chat session in which Bazer picks the brains of local celebrities. Scheduled to appear tonight are author Rebecca Skloot (The Immortal Life of Henrietta Lacks), Moto chef Homaro Cantu, and theater director Henry Wishcamper (Other Desert Cities). There will also be a performance by local rockers the Stone Chromatics.

Have you ever been told it’s Shatner’s World: We Just Live in It? Neither have I, but that’s the title of William Shatner’s autobiographical one-man show, which he performs tonight at the Paramount Theatre. Here’s hoping he takes a moment to share some choice cuts from his 1968 album The Transformed Man.

Ian’s Party, a three-day music festival featuring some of the city’s best punk bands, begins tonight. Bands scheduled to appear over the weekend include the Arrivals, the House That Gloria Vanderbilt, and Dr. Manhattan, among others. Township and Quenchers share hosting duties, ensuring plenty of cheap beer for all.
